Sweet Ragi Roti.. finger millet is a very common ingredient in our home and whenever I go home to my parents my mom sends back some freshly milled millet flour. I make Puttu or kozhukattai or even bread with them. Roti too nowadays, thanks to the north Indian food influencers tempting us with all those missi Roti, bajra Roti etc., My mom always have made savory Roti or flat bread with finger millet flour.. you know loads of chopped Onion, moringa leaves ,green chillies and cooked on an iron tawa with Ghee. Recipe for these gluten free, Healthy sweet Ragi Roti is below.. please note I have measured in cups, not grams for this recipe. Measure in any cup the same ratio. Add more coconut if you like, or sweet as you like.


Ingredients
Ragi flour- 1 cup
Grated coconut – 1/2 cup
Jaggery – 1/3 cup, melted in 1/2 cup hot water
Salt – 1 large pinch
Cardamom seeds – powdered
Ghee to cook

Method
1. In a large bowl add all ingredients except Ghee and make a pliable dough
2. Divide equally into large lemon sized balls
3. Flatten with hands or roll as you like and cook in a hot Tawa with Ghee on both the sides
4. Enjoy
